Petro Harvester Operating Co. v. Keith

954 F.3d 686 (5th Cir. 2020)
JurisdictionUnited States
CourtUnited States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it
Year2020
StatusBinding authority

Key Principle

A later surface lease does not supersede the implied surface easement of a prior-severed mineral estate, and a duty to restore the surface arises only where express language imposes it; affirmative defenses such as waiver, ratification and estoppel fail absent supporting facts.
